LifeStance Health Group (NASDAQ:LFST – Get Free Report) had its target price upped by equities research analysts at KeyCorp from $8.00 to $9.00 in a research report issued to clients and investors on Thursday,Benzinga reports. The firm presently has an “overweight” rating on the stock. KeyCorp’s price objective would suggest a potential upside of 26.85% from the stock’s previous close.
A number of other research analysts have also weighed in on the stock. BTIG Research raised their price target on shares of LifeStance Health Group from $10.00 to $11.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research report on Monday, February 2nd. Zacks Research lowered shares of LifeStance Health Group from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Wednesday, November 5th. Weiss Ratings reissued a “sell (d-)” rating on shares of LifeStance Health Group in a research report on Monday, December 29th. Barclays assumed coverage on LifeStance Health Group in a research note on Tuesday, December 9th. They issued an “overweight” rating and a $8.00 target price on the stock. Finally, BMO Capital Markets began coverage on LifeStance Health Group in a research report on Thursday, November 13th. They set an “outperform” rating and a $8.00 price target for the company.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, six have issued a Buy rating, one has assigned a Hold rating and one has given a Sell r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us price target of $9.00.

LifeStance Health Group Stock Down 4.3%
LifeStance Health Group (NASDAQ:LFST –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ported $0.03 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.05 by ($0.02). The company had revenue of $382.20 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$378.51 million. LifeStance Health Group had a negative net margin of 0.67% and a negative return on equity of 0.62%. LifeStance Health Group’s revenue was up 17.4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the business posted ($0.01) earnings per share. On average, equities research analysts forecast that LifeStance Health Group will post -0.18 earnings per share for the current year.
LifeStance Health Group declared that its Board of Directors has authorized a share repurchase program on Wednesday, February 25th that allows the company to buyback $100.00 million in shares. This buyback authorization allows the company to buy up to 3.6% of its stock through open market purchases. Stock buyback programs are typically a sign that the company’s leadership believes its shares are undervalued.

LifeStance Health Group Company Profile
LifeStance Health Group (NASDAQ:LFST) is a leading provider of outpatient mental health services in the United States. Headquartered in New York City, the company operates a growing network of clinics that deliver integrated, patient-centered psychological and psychiatric care. LifeStance’s mission is to expand access to high-quality mental health treatment by combining evidence-based therapy modalities with personalized treatment plans.
The company’s service offerings include individual, family, and group psychotherapy, psychiatric medication management, psychological assessment, and telehealth services.
